Service Provider Foundations Learning Modules
The versions of the Service Provider Foundations curriculum modules available on yourtickettowork.ssa.gov allow all Employment Networks (EN) to access the same required training that new ENs and new key points of contact at existing ENs must complete. Social Security is providing these modules online for information purposes only. Please note that Social Security does not track the completion of the modules on this page and accessing these modules will not count toward any training requirements listed in the TPA. If you are required to take the Service Provider Foundations training as a new EN, new key point of contact at an existing EN, or due to a site visit, you must complete the training by contacting ENOperations@ssa.gov.

MODULE 1: Completing the Suitability Process
Learn to complete the suitability process, which includes including filling out forms, gathering information, completing the eApp, fingerprinting, and responding to the suitability determination. EN personnel must complete suitability before working with Ticketholders and accessing Personally Identifiable Information (PII).

MODULE 2: Overview of the Ticket to Work Program
Explore the Ticket to Work Program, its key components, administration of the program, stakeholder duties and responsibilities, Work Incentives for Ticketholders, benefits for participants, and resources for ENs.

MODULE 3: Properly Safeguarding Personally Identifiable Information (PII)
Understand PII basics, safeguarding PII when sending and managing it, best practices to ensure the privacy of Ticketholder PII, how to identify and report PII violations, and the consequences of PII violations.

MODULE 4: Timely Progress Review (TPR) Process
Discover what Timely Progress Review and medical Continuing Disability Review (CDR) protection are, how to communicate important information about TPRs, what the review requirements are, and how to assist Ticketholders with the TPR process.

MODULE 5: The Ticketholder Intake Process
Explore an overview of the Ticketholder intake process, EN responsibilities and Ticketholder needs, IWP Discussion Summary requirements, best practices for intake discussions, and Ticket Program intake resources.

MODULE 6: Preparing the Individual Work Plan (IWP)
Learn IWP requirements and best practices, which include using Ticket Program resources, writing Ticketholder goals and related services and supports, protocol for IWP signatures and dates, and maintaining the IWP. This module follows IWP form template SSA-1370.

MODULE 7: Services and Supports Review
Understand what a Services and Supports Review is, review requirements, the notice of review and request for documentation, how to respond to the request for documentation, the Outcome Summary Report, and handling non-compliance review responses.

MODULE 8: Payment Process Overview
Explore the basic elements of the Ticket Program’s payment process for compensating ENs, which include Phase 1 Milestone exclusions, the 18-Month Look Back Rule, Phase 1 Milestone relationship requirements, payments after Ticket unassignment, and receiving payments.

MODULE 9: Partnership Plus Collaboration
Discover the basics of the Partnership Plus process, roles of key stakeholders, benefits of participating in Partnership Plus, and how to position your EN to partner with a State Vocational Rehabilitation (VR) agency.

MODULE 10: Introduction to Section 503 for Employment Networks (EN)
Understand the basics of Section 503 of the Rehabilitation Act of 1973, along with how to engage with federal contractors, prepare Ticketholders for Section 503 opportunities, and leverage this knowledge to better serve your clients.

MODULE 11: Employment Network (EN) Marketing Part 1: Research and Planning
Understand marketing as a business discipline, including the four principles: research, planning, implementation and evaluation. EN Marketing Part 1 focuses on research and planning and introduces Ticket Program marketing resources.

MODULE 12: Employment Network (EN) Marketing Part 2: Marketing Strategies to Promote your EN
Discover how to implement your EN marketing plan and promote Ticket Program services. EN Marketing Part 2 focuses on marketing implementation, content to help you succeed, evaluation and next steps.
